Clinicopathologic profile of intra-abdominal follicular dendritic cell sarcoma: A study of three cases with a literature review.

Abstract

Follicular dendritic cell sarcoma (FDCS) is a rare tumor, which mainly originates from follicular dendritic cells (FDCs) in the lymph nodes. Sometimes FDCS can arise from outside the lymph nodes. FDCS is an extremely rare malignant tumor in intraperitoneal or retroperitoneal tissue. We gathered the detailed clinical data of three patients diagnosed with FDCS in the abdomen. The clinical observations and histopathologic and immunohistochemical features of FDCS were analyzed. The patients included two men and one woman aged 55 ~ 61 years old. The mesentery of the small intestine and colon was involved in case 1, spleen in case 2, and retroperitoneal tissues in case 3. Two patients presented with abdominal masses, and one presented with no obvious symptoms. Histology showed ovoid to spindle neoplastic cells arranged in fascicles and storiforms with inflammatory infiltrate as well as whorled patterns in some areas. Immunohistochemical staining was positive for CD21, CD23, CD35, and SSTR2. FDCS exhibits no characteristic clinical manifestations. Morphologically, FDCS can have overlapping features with many other entities, leading to misdiagnosis. The use of histopathology supplemented with FDC markers, such as CD21, CD23, and CD35, is useful for diagnosis and differential diagnosis.

摘要

滤泡树突细胞肉瘤(FDCS)是一种罕见的肿瘤,主要起源于淋巴结中的滤泡树突细胞(FDCs)。有时 FDCS 也可能发生在淋巴结外。FDCS 是一种极其罕见的发生在腹膜内或腹膜后组织的恶性肿瘤。我们收集了三例在腹部诊断为 FDCS 的患者的详细临床资料。分析了 FDCS 的临床观察、组织病理学和免疫组织化学特征。患者包括 2 名男性和 1 名女性,年龄 55~61 岁。第 1 例累及小肠和结肠系膜,第 2 例累及脾脏,第 3 例累及腹膜后组织。2 例患者表现为腹部肿块,1 例患者无明显症状。组织学表现为卵圆形至梭形的肿瘤细胞呈束状和席纹状排列,伴有炎症浸润,部分区域呈漩涡状。免疫组织化学染色 CD21、CD23、CD35 和 SSTR2 阳性。FDCS 无特征性临床表现。形态上,FDCS 与许多其他实体具有重叠特征,导致误诊。组织病理学结合 FDC 标志物(如 CD21、CD23 和 CD35)的使用有助于诊断和鉴别诊断。
